MEA Apostille Process Explained: From Verification to Final Approval

  If you are planning to study, work, settle, or do business abroad , apostille of Indian documents is often a mandatory requirement. In India, apostille is issued only by the Ministry of External Affairs (MEA) . However, many applicants are confused about how the MEA apostille process actually works. This guide explains the complete MEA apostille process step by step , from initial verification to final approval, in simple terms. What Is MEA Apostille? MEA apostille is an official authentication issued by the Ministry of External Affairs, Government of India , under the Hague Convention . It confirms that a document issued in India is genuine and legally valid in Hague Convention countries.   Which Documents Require MEA Apostille? Marriage Certificate Attestation in India: Step-by-Step Guide

Marriage certificate attestation is required for spouse visas, dependent visas, family residency, and legal purposes abroad . It proves the authenticity of a legally registered marriage in India. This guide explains the complete marriage certificate attestation process in India . Why Is Marriage Certificate Attestation Required? Marriage certificate attestation is required for: Spouse or dependent visa Family residence permit Name change or legal recognition abroad Apostille or Attestation for Marriage Certificate ? Hague countries → Apostille Non-Hague countries → Attestation Step-by-Step Marriage Certificate Attestation Process Step 1: Notary / State Authentication The marriage certificate is verified at the state level. Step 2: MEA Attestation The Ministry of External Affairs authenticates the document. Step 3: Embassy Attestation (If Required) Mandatory for non-Hague countries. Apostille for USA, Germany, Italy & France: Country-Wise Guide

  If you are planning to study, work, settle, or do business abroad , apostille of Indian documents is a mandatory requirement for many countries. The USA, Germany, Italy, and France are all members of the Hague Convention , which means Indian documents must be apostilled to be legally accepted there. This country-wise guide explains apostille requirements, documents, and usage for these four popular destinations. What Is Apostille and Why Is It Required? An apostille is an international authentication issued by the Ministry of External Affairs (MEA), India , that validates Indian documents for use in Hague Convention countries.
